Initially, reflect on the design of your laundry room. Smart utilization of space is crucial, particularly in smaller areas. I discovered that stacking the washer and dryer creates floor space, giving me room for extra storage or a folding station. Should space permits, integrating a countertop above adjacent appliances offers a useful surface for folding clothes directly after using the dryer.

Storage is another essential element to think about. Cabinets and shelves can keep cleaning supplies, detergents, and other items neatly arranged and within reach. In my experience, utilizing tagged baskets or bins on open shelves gives a neat, uniform look while maintaining everything in its place. Should your laundry room has minimal space, wall-mounted cabinets can provide more storage that doesn’t require precious floor space.

Including a sink into your laundry room can be a major improvement. It’s ideal for handwashing special care items or managing stains before washing. If plumbing permits, I advise installing a deep utility sink that can handle bigger tasks, like soaking items or cleaning tools.

Lighting also has a vital role in making the space practical. Good task lighting guarantees you are able to see what you’re handling when separating, folding, or addressing stains. Under-counter lighting is a excellent option for brightening work surfaces, while a ceiling fixture can offer overall lighting for the room.

Finally, don’t neglect to bring in some personality into your laundry room. A bright coat of paint, fun wallpaper, or decorative accents could make the space feel more welcoming. I like bringing in touches like artwork, plants, or even a stylish rug to introduce warmth and character to the room.
